Vin Diesel presented at the Golden Globe awards on Sunday night and made quite the entrance. When the Fast & Furious star walked on stage to present the award for Best Blockbuster Achievement (given to Wicked: Part One), he made a sly joke at The Rock’s expense.
Given the reported beef between The Rock and Vin Diesel in the past, the Guardians of the Galaxy voice actor decided to draw attention to that fact by sauntering on stage and greeting Dwayne ‘The Rock’ Johnson directly.
“Hey, Dwayne,” Diesel said with a grin as he took up his position at the microphone to present the award, creating a moment that instantly went viral on social media.

With The Rock’s character of Luke Hobbs appearing at the tail end of Fast X and set to appear in the upcoming sequel, it would appear that the two have patched up their relationship, at least to the extent that they can be cordial and crack jokes in public.
Set to release in 2026, the next Fast & Furious film will be the 11th in the franchise, with Diesel confirming that the movie will be the final installment in the main series. There have also been reports about a spinoff featuring Johnson and Jason Momoa, who made his debut in Fast X.
